New DofE consultation that seeks views on options for the future of the Care to Learn childcare support scheme for young parents in education or training in England, from September 2012.

NB - Care to Learn provides non income-assessed support for childcare and associated travel costs to young parents of up to £160 a week (£175 in London) to enable them to complete their education, gain qualifications and enter employment. Childcare payments are made direct to the childcare provider. In academic year 2009/10 the programme cost around £37 million and provided childcare support to 7,933 young parents.

Closing Date: Friday 28 October 2011
